Description and Service Details
Description (Service) |
Services for people on the autism spectrum disorder and their families * some events and programs are offered virtually * check website for details
- Community events: hosts fun, interactive events, designed to bring the autism community together and empower guests to socialize in safe and entertaining environments. Our signature event, the annual Holiday Party, has been welcoming and spreading joy amongst hundreds of families for 15 years
- Legends Mentoring program: hosts themed group workshops, such as art, athletic and tech workshops, providing youth on the spectrum with opportunities to learn skills, socialize and make friends, all under the guidance of caring mentors
- Employment mentoring: supports the integration of young adults with autism into the workforce through paid placements and mentorship, and connects employers with qualified candidates
- Inclusive Housing Program: currently in development in collaboration with community partners from multiple sectors, these long-term care solutions are designed to address the growing housing gap in the autism community, giving more aging adults on the spectrum a place to call home
- volunteer mentor opportunities available
